How does a scientist’s h-index change over time?

WebWe found that, on average, assistant professors have an h-index of 2-5, associate professors 6-10, and full professors 12-24. These are mean or median values only—the distribution of values at each rank is very wide. If you hope to win a Nobel Prize, your h-index should be at least 35 and preferably closer to 70. So, if you are just starting out, try to collaborate with the … WebClearly, an author's h -index can only be as great as their number of publications. For example, an author with only one publication can have a maximum h -index of 1 (if their publication has 1 or more citations). On the other hand, an author with many publications, each with only 1 citation, would also have a h -index of 1. market watch trep stock

The h-index is a measure of a researcher's (or a group of researchers') effect on the field. The h value indicates that the author, group, or institution has produced at least h articles, each of which has received at least h citations.
